How Much Does Double Glazing Repair Cost?

doorpanels-300x200.jpgDouble-glazed windows are energy efficient and enhance security in your home. They are also easy to clean and boost the value of your home.

Double-pane window prices depend on the frame material, size, insulation capability, and coatings. They are available in a range of designs and colors to fit any budget. There are also a variety of options for the gap between panes like air or argon.

Replacement Glass Cost

Your glazier will replace damaged glass by using double-glazed units. The cost will be between $75 and $210 based on the work needed to repair. A damaged window occurs when a gap opens up between the window panels which allows moisture to get into the window and cause fogging or misting. This could be due damage to the window's seals or the deterioration that occurs with time. Windows that have been damaged by blows should be repaired as soon as they can to avoid further damage and avoid costly repairs.

Cost of Replacement Seals

The condensation that occurs between the panes of the windows is among the most frequent issues homeowners face with double glazing. This is typically a sign that the thermal seal has been damaged, and can reduce the energy efficiency of windows. Window professionals can repair or replace the thermal seal to correct this issue. They can also consider resealing the windows, which can improve insulation and reduce the cost of electricity.

The cost to replace or repair one glass pane in a double-glazed window can vary from $50 to 200, depending on its size and complexity. Homeowners are also able to reseal their windows in order to save money, but it's important to understand the procedure and Upvc Door Repairs Near Me follow the instructions carefully. To ensure that the job is done right, it's best to hire a professional.

Window experts use special products that seal windows to keep out moisture. They apply a specific type of caulk that's designed to seal the window. Then, they clean the edges and surface of the frame with a clean, dry cloth to remove any excess caulk. During this process, they also check for leaks and damage to the glazing and frames.

In addition to sealing, window experts may also have to replace or repair any binding mechanisms that keep the sashes together. This procedure can be complex, and it's usually better to delegate the task to an expert. They'll be able to handle the delicate job safely and quickly.

Certain manufacturers offer warranties on their windows. These can last up to two decades and could be able to cover the cost of repairs caused by a defective or damaged thermal seal. It is recommended to contact the manufacturer to find out more.
